Discover how to set movable metal and wood type to produce a unique letterpress printed piece just as Johannes Gutenberg did in 1452.


Set a poem, a bookmark, personal stationery, or greeting card. Learn the importance of leading and how to properly adjust the line spacing of your form. Become familiar with common type sizes, word spaces and quads. Set type flush left, flush right, centered and justified. Properly tie up your form and pull a proof.


Then you will be taught about furniture, quoins, and reglets as you lock-up your form in a chase, ready for the press. You will learn how to lubricate the press, apply ink, adjust impression, set guides, and print your project on a hand or foot treadle operated Platen press.


While your beautiful printed pieces dry, you will learn to properly wash-up the press, and then explore other opportunities at Dock 2 Letterpress.
